10 Fascinating 2026 FIFA World Cup Records & Stats You Probably Missed

The 2026 FIFA World Cup delivered unforgettable matches, surprise underdogs, and plenty of history. While Spain lifted the trophy after defeating Argentina 1-0 in extra time, the tournament produced countless records and remarkable statistics that flew under the radar.

Here are ten of the most interesting facts from football's biggest event.

1. Spain Became Two-Time World Champions
Spain added a second World Cup title to their collection, 16 years after their famous 2010 triumph. Their latest success came courtesy of Ferran Torres' extra-time winner against Argentina in the final.

 

2. Haaland Finally Lit Up the World Cup
After missing previous editions because Norway failed to qualify, Erling Haaland made his World Cup debut in style. He scored seven goals, inspired Norway to their best-ever World Cup finish, and became one of the tournament's biggest stars almost overnight.

 

3. Norway Eliminated Brazil
One of the biggest shocks came in the Round of 16 when Norway knocked out five-time champions Brazil. Haaland's clinical finishing ended Brazil's title hopes and sent Norway into uncharted territory.

 

4. Messi Reached a Third World Cup Final
At 39 years old, Lionel Messi played in his third FIFA World Cup final (2014, 2022 and 2026), matching Cafu as the only men's players to reach three World Cup finals. Although Argentina fell short, Messi once again proved he could perform on football's biggest stage.

 

5. The World Cup Expanded to 48 Teams
The 2026 tournament featured 48 nations for the first time, increasing the number of matches and giving several countries their World Cup debut, including Cape Verde, Curaçao and Haiti.

 

6. Rodri was the Midfield General
Spain's Rodri was widely regarded as the tournament's standout player thanks to his composure, leadership and consistency throughout the knockout rounds, helping control matches from midfield.

 

7. Mbappé Finished as Golden Boot Winner
France may have missed out on the final, but Kylian Mbappé finished the tournament as the top scorer. His outstanding campaign also extended his incredible World Cup scoring record, strengthening his place among the competition's all-time great goalscorers.

 

8. England's Best Finish Since 2018
England reached another World Cup semi-final before eventually defeating France 6-4 in a thrilling third-place playoff, giving the Three Lions a podium finish after another impressive tournament.

 

9. Defense won the Trophy
Spain built their title run on discipline rather than simply outscoring opponents. Their organized defense and controlled possession proved decisive throughout the knockout stage, culminating in a clean sheet in the final.

 

10. The Final Needed Extra Time
For 105 minutes, neither Spain nor Argentina could find the breakthrough. Ferran Torres finally settled the contest in the 106th minute, delivering one of the latest winning goals in a World Cup final and securing Spain's place in football history.

 

Bonus Fact
Although Spain won the trophy, one of the tournament's breakout stories was Erling Haaland. After years of watching Norway miss out on the World Cup, he finally arrived on the biggest stage and immediately became one of its biggest attractions, combining seven goals with a historic run to the quarter-finals that put Norwegian football firmly in the global spotlight.
